In New Mexico, what training focus helps officers recognize and address racial profiling?

Explanation:
The emphasis on bias awareness training in New Mexico is designed to equip officers with the skills needed to identify and combat racial profiling. This type of training specifically focuses on helping law enforcement personnel understand their own implicit biases as well as the broader societal factors that contribute to racial profiling. By increasing awareness of these issues, officers learn to acknowledge how their perceptions and decisions can be influenced by race and other demographic factors, enabling them to engage with all community members more equitably and justly. While crisis intervention training, de-escalation training, and community policing training are important for various aspects of law enforcement, they do not specifically target the recognition and mitigation of bias in policing practices. Crisis intervention training focuses on handling mental health crises, de-escalation training emphasizes techniques to reduce tensions in volatile situations, and community policing promotes collaborative relationships with community members. Each of these plays a role in effective policing, but bias awareness training uniquely addresses the critical issue of racial profiling.

What are the eligibility requirements for the LEOC exam in New Mexico?

To take the LEOC exam in New Mexico, candidates must be at least 21 years old, have a high school diploma or GED, and complete a state-approved law enforcement training program. Meeting these requirements ensures that candidates are prepared for the responsibilities of law enforcement positions in the state.
